Cologne wants to save energy. To use less electricity, traffic lights should be switched off. An application is now being examined.
Cologne – The first energy-saving measures in Cologne have been running since the beginning of August. Now the next concepts are under discussion. One suggestion: The traffic lights in the district of Cologne-Ehrenfeld should be switched off. A corresponding application is now to be examined.

“The energy crisis is forcing us to save energy. In addition to lowering room temperatures, we will also have to save electricity wherever possible,” says the application by the CDU in Cologne, among other things. (jw)
